Output 24fbdfd0e157ef0d9f831867d7f6dfcdcbb0e1c590b642de187d5d912943d04a:0

value
689
script pubkey
OP_0 OP_PUSHBYTES_20 b7395d905c913b49da1d51a100a5dcd610a1de38
address
bc1qkuu4myzujya5nksa2xsspfwu6cg2rh3cy8qlej
transaction
24fbdfd0e157ef0d9f831867d7f6dfcdcbb0e1c590b642de187d5d912943d04a
confirmations
29
spent
true